Many investors open a brokerage account to start saving for retirement. However, the flexibility of this type of account means you can withdraw at any time and use the funds for shorter-term goals, too, such as a new house, wedding, or big remodeling project. There is an annual account fee for all accounts. For the most common brokerage and standard IRA accounts this is $20 per year. Vanguard waives the fee if you sign up for e-delivery of statements. Oct 5, 2023 · Vanguard’s mutual funds and ETFs aren’t just low cost; they’re significantly less expensive than the industry average. Vanguard’s average expense ratio is 0.09%. Parents, grandparents, and family members can establish custodial accounts for minor children. When the child reaches the legal age of majority, commonly 18 ...

At Vanguard you're more than just an investor, you're an owner. Vanguard isn't owned by public shareholders. It's owned by the people who invest in our funds.*.
